    So how do I implement this in the game? It's downloaded as a patch...so what folder to I put it in, etc. ??

    Find your Cities XL game folder and place it in /Paks. If your running steam and you have windows 7 it's easy to find by right clicking the game's shortcut and clicking "Open File Location".
